Why was Mosaic important? - Answer-Mosaic was the first graphics-capable browser. It
ushered in the world of user-friendly browsers such as Netscape, Internet Explorer, and
Firefox.

Discuss the browser wars - Answer-Netscape Navigator and Internet Explorer were the
big competing user-friendly browsers. Microsoft's IE was bundled with the Window's
operating, giving IE the edge, which led to a monopoly lawsuit. However, the damage
was done and IE was the winner.

describe how the Web changed after 2002 - Answer-The advent of social networking
sites allowed users to provide content to Internet sites. Blogging, both personal and
professional also changed the character of Internet content. This change is sometimes
referred to as Web 2

Name the four areas in which the practitioner must be skilled - Answer-Algorithmic
thinking, representation (of data storage), programming, and design

Distinguish between computing as a tool and computing as a discipline. - Answer-
Computing as a tool refers to the use of computing to solve problems in a person's
professional or personal life. Computing as a discipline refers to the study of the body of
knowledge that makes up computer science and/or computer engineering

What do we mean by the statement that the 1980s an 1990s must be characterized by
the changing profile of the user? - Answer-The original user was the programmer who
had a problem to solve. By the 1970s, application programs were being written such
that non-programmers could use them to solve problems. With the advent of the
personal computer, many people began using the computer for personal
correspondence, personal accounts, and games.
